Features in depth

Clean, stable analog output
The SSG3000X is built around a low-noise synthesizer, so it delivers a clean carrier for receiver, component and education work without the price of a microwave instrument.
- −110 dBc/Hz phase noise @ 1 GHz, 20 kHz offset (typ.)
- Level from −110 dBm to +13 dBm with a built-in attenuator
- Fine frequency resolution across the whole range
- Stable enough to serve as an LO or clock reference
Modulation & vector-ready
Beyond a plain carrier, it covers the everyday modulation jobs — and the -IQE models open the door to vector signals when you need them.
- AM, FM & PM analog modulation, internal or external
- Pulse modulation with ≥70 dBc on/off ratio
- Built-in pulse-train generator for radar-style bursts
- -IQE: external I/Q input — drive it from an SDG6000X for digital/vector modulation

Full specifications
| Frequency range | 9 kHz – 2.1 GHz (SSG3021X) / 3.2 GHz (SSG3032X) |
| Phase noise | −110 dBc/Hz @ 1 GHz, 20 kHz offset (typ.) |
| Output level | −110 dBm to +13 dBm |
| Analog modulation | AM, FM, PM (internal / external) |
| Pulse modulation | On/off ratio ≥ 70 dBc |
| Pulse train | Built-in generator |
| Vector / IQ | External I/Q on -IQE models (with SDG6000X baseband) |
| Sweep | Frequency & level sweep, list mode |
| Reference | Internal TCXO; 10 MHz in/out |
| Interfaces | LAN (LXI) · USB · GPIB · SCPI |
From the official SSG3000X Series datasheet; subject to change, errors & omissions excepted.
